不同版本的SCCM 2007客户端安装在整个环境中

我想知道为什么我看到在我的环境中安装了多个SCCM 2007客户端版本,而不仅仅是一个?

我去年把我的SCCM 2007服务器升级到R3,我的大部分系统(其中约3400个)显示正确的版本(4.00.6487.2157)。 但是当我运行一个报告时,我发现大约900个版本仍然有Service Pack 2版本(4.00.6486.2000),甚至34个版本都有KB977384版本(4.00.6487.2188)。 我真的不明白。 我在哪里可以看到客户端本身拉实际的客户端版本信息。 我查看了“HKLM \ Software \ Microsoft \ SMS \ Mobile Client \ Product Version”的值,但即使在我的报告显示安装了4.00.6487.2157版本的系统上,该registry值仍显示为4.00.6486.2000。

我们正在升级到SCCM 2012,我被pipe理层询问了这个问题,关于不同的SCCM 2007客户端版本。

有人能帮我理解这个吗?

谢谢

如果工作站的sccm客户端软件被破坏,那么客户端将不会更新,即使它更新了,如果客户端以某种方式损坏,那么它也不会报告,并且您正在处理旧数据。

对我们来说最合适的就是通过组策略部署一个login脚本,检查安装的sccm版本,如果不匹配所需的版本,就更新它。 它也检查wmi腐败和不同的事情,但我相信你明白了。

还有很多东西(以sccm计算的运动部件数量),我不太了解,但是我知道的很多。 微软也有一些technet页面,部署sccm客户端的最佳实践,你可以看看。